Spec-Zone .ru
спецификации, руководства, описания, API
|
Если Вы не уверены, включат ли браузерам Ваших конечных пользователей интерпретатору JavaScript, можно развернуть свой апплет Java, вручную кодируя <applet>
HTML-тэг, вместо того, чтобы использовать функции Инструментария Развертывания. В зависимости от браузеров Вы должны поддерживать, Вы, возможно, должны развернуть свой апплет Java, используя <object>
или <embed>
HTML-тэг. Проверьте Спецификацию HTML W3C на детали об использовании этих тегов.
Можно запустить свой апплет, используя Протокол Запуска Сети Java (JNLP) или определить атрибуты запуска непосредственно в <applet>
тег.
Следуйте за шагами, описанными в
AppletPage_WithAppletTag.html
страница развертывает Динамический Древовидный Демонстрационный апплет с <applet>
тег, который был вручную кодирован (значение, апплет не развертывается, используя Инструментарий Развертывания, который автоматически генерирует необходимый HTML). Апплет все еще запускается, используя JNLP. Файл JNLP определяется в jnlp_href
атрибут.
<applet code = 'appletComponentArch.DynamicTreeApplet' jnlp_href = 'dynamictree-applet.jnlp', width = 300, height = 300 />
Если Ваш апплет не нуждается в специальных полномочиях, чтобы выполнить определенные секретные операции, можно также развернуть свой апплет без файла JNLP.
AppletPage_WithAppletTagNoJNLP.html
развертывает Динамический Древовидный Демонстрационный апплет как показано в следующем фрагменте кода.
<applet code = 'appletComponentArch.DynamicTreeApplet' archive = 'DynamicTreeDemo.jar', width = 300, height = 300 />
где
code
имя апплета classarchive
имя файла фляги, содержащего апплет и его ресурсыwidth
width апплетаheight
height апплета